2. They Can Help You Deal With Insurance Companies

You may be dealing with costly medical bills and lost wages due to being unable to work and physical and emotional pain and suffering. To make matters even more difficult you may have to deal with a car insurance company that is reluctant to give you the money you deserve. This is the time to consult an attorney.

A New York City car accident attorney can ease the stress by negotiating on your behalf with insurance companies. They will ensure that the insurance company is aware of your injuries and losses, and will help you receive an equitable amount of compensation. A lawyer can also help you avoid mistakes that could endanger your case.

One common mistake is accepting a settlement that is less than the value of your claim. Insurance adjusters often try to use any excuse to reduce the value your claim. This includes claiming you are partially responsible for the accident. (This is not legal in New York.) A lawyer can assist you combat these tactics and ensure that you get the compensation you are entitled to.

Another common mistake is misunderstanding the severity of your injuries and the extent of your injuries and. An experienced lawyer for car accidents can assess your injuries and document them in a clear and concise manner so that the insurance company can provide you with the maximum amount of compensation. A lawyer can also assist you with third party claims, such those from your health, disability, or worker's comp insurers.

An attorney can also assist you with any requests made by the insurance company for you to sign any documents or make a an account of the accident. An attorney will always review any documents they ask you to sign before you sign them to ensure they don't limit your legal rights or prevent you from receiving the full value of your claim.

You can handle your insurance claim yourself when you're involved in a minor accident which results in just the amount of a few thousand dollars in property damage. However, if you are seriously injured or your losses and expenses are significant, it is recommended to speak with an attorney as soon as possible.

4. They can help you avoid making mistakes.

The insurance landscape is complex and complex and a lapse at any time can greatly impact the success of your claim. A lawyer for car accidents can assist you in avoiding common mistakes, including not understanding legal terminology or providing details to an insurance company that could be used against you.

A common error is to fail to gather all the documents you need to file a claim. This includes police reports, witness statements, medical records and any other documents related to your injury or accident. Your attorney will make sure that all of this is properly gathered and used to make a convincing case on your behalf.

Another common mistake is not seeking medical attention. Even if you feel that your injuries aren't serious, it's important to have them checked by a doctor to ensure that any hidden or internal injuries are recorded. This could also strengthen your case since it proves that the injuries you sustained were directly related to an accident.

It is also important to keep track all of the expenses that you have incurred due to the accident. You could use documents such as prescription receipts and medical bills to document the financial burden you've incurred.

It is crucial that you do not make any false admissions to your insurance company. Even if you were not responsible for the incident and you are not at fault, admitting any form of blame could reduce the amount of compensation you receive. Your lawyer will contact the insurance company on your behalf and assist you in avoiding making statements that could be construed as an admission of guilt.
